Tips:当你看到这个提示的时候,说明当前的文章是由原emlog博客系统搬迁至此的,文章发布时间已过于久远,编排和内容不一定完整,还请谅解`
实现 Emlog 最新评论列表不显示博主的评论回复
日期:2017-5-6 阿珏 折腾代码 浏览:1984 次 评论:0 条
博主需要经常和访客互动,博主的回复也作为一条评论在最新评论处显示,这样一来,如果博主如果一次回复好几条评论留言,那么在最新评论的地方显示的都是自己的评论,这样不太好。
以我当前的emlog 5.3.1 版本为例:
打开include/lib目录下的cache.php文件(这是个缓存函数文件)在其中找到以下代码:
我的是在179行,如下
将其修改为:
提示:这是一段执行SQL语句的PHP代码,条件是检测评论用户的用户名是不是博主的用户名,是则不显示该评论到最新评论列表。(也可以通过检测邮箱网址的 poster!=‘阿珏’,毕竟我自己回复是不带邮箱的,所以只能检测用户名了,当然 不要冒充我)